Respuesta :

y=f(x+1)-4

The dotted graph moved down 4 so the answer had to have -4 and the graph moved to the left 1. What is inside the () causes the graph to move either left or right. Because it moved left 1 you add 1 to x. What’s inside the parenthesis is the opposite of what happens on the graph.( when the graph moves left you add and when it goes to the right you subtract)
